The Role
The Teacher Leaders in Residence (TLIR) provides proprietary Professional Learning (PL) from Open Up Resources around high-quality curricula. This role is best suited for zealous teachers who are in the classroom, implementing the Open Up Resources curricula with integrity, passion, and effective teaching practices. They are ready to take their leadership to the next level without leaving the classroom. TLIRs will share about their authentic experiences, while being ready to think on their feet to collaborate around implementation questions and challenges, along with celebrating successes and student learning. TLIRs will be in close communication with the TLIR Manager to facilitate events and they will work thoughtfully through resources to execute the PL effectively and with integrity.
TLIR applicants may or may not have experience in facilitating professional learning.
